What To Look For When Looking For DJ Equipment For Sale
When buying your DJ equipment, understand the types of equipment available, their condition, pricing, and potential cosmetic damages is crucial. DJ gear usually includes turntables, mixers, controllers, speakers, headphones, and disco lights. Turntables and also controllers are necessary for mixing songs, with turntables you get a classic feel and controllers help you by providing modern digital interfaces. Mixers, which come in various sizes and capabilities, are key for blending music smoothly.
The wear of your DJ equipment you find for sale can range from brand new to used. New DJ equipment for sale offers the latest technology and warranties but comes at a higher price. Used equipment can be a cost-effective alternative, often available at a fraction of the cost. However, it’s important to check the functionality of all components. Items in excellent condition may show minimal wear and tear, while those in fair condition might exhibit signs of extensive use, such as faded buttons or scratches.
How Much To Pay For DJ Equipment You Find For Sale
Pricing varies significantly based on the equipment type, brand, and condition. High-end brands like Pioneer or Numark command higher prices, even for used items, due to their durability and performance. Entry-level brands are more affordable but might lack advanced features.
Cosmetic damages, such as scratches, dents, or faded labels, don’t necessarily impact the functionality but can affect the equipment’s aesthetic appeal. When buying used gear, it’s essential to inspect for these damages and consider their impact on resale value.
In summary, when looking for DJ equipment for sale, weigh the pros and cons of new versus used items, check the condition thoroughly, and be mindful of any cosmetic damages to make an informed purchase.

Other essentials for first-time DJ controller buyers include EQ functionality, play and cue buttons, pitch faders, and line and cross-faders. Having a deck with all the buttons, sliders, and platters arranged in a sensible manner is also pleasant.
To DJ using a laptop and digital music, a DJ controller is required. For vinyl record DJing, however, you’ll need a turntable and mixer. Additionally, you’ll need: laptop running DJ software (should you choose for the DJ Controller method)

Professional installations often consist of two media players such as Pioneer CDJ-2000NXS or CDJ-3000 and a Pioneer DJM series club mixer, however many clubs employ laptop-based DJ setups that give a wider variety of controllers. Though less frequent, traditional DJ equipment setups using record decks are still utilized in scenes that emphasize vinyl.
